WebSep 13, 2024 · Method 1: Using matplotlib.patches.Circle () function. Matplotlib has a special function matplotlib.patches.Circle () in order to plot circles. Syntax: class matplotlib.patches.Circle (xy, radius=5, **kwargs) Example 1: Plotting a colored Circle using matplotlib.patches.Circle () Python3. import matplotlib.pyplot as plt. WebNov 14, 2024 · Curve fitting is a type of optimization that finds an optimal set of parameters for a defined function that best fits a given set of observations. Unlike supervised learning, curve fitting requires that you define the function that maps examples of inputs to outputs. The mapping function, also called the basis function can have any form you ...
